Emaar apartment sales decline 85%, villa sales increase
March 25, 2012 by DubaiChronicle.com · Comments Off
According to Emaar’s financial statement posted on Dubai’s stock market today, the developer’s revenue from apartment sales plunged 85 percent in 2011. Sale of villas increased 85 percent during the same period.
Income from apartment sales dropped to 1.11 billion dirhams ($303 million) from 7.56 billion dirhams a year earlier. Revenue from sale of villas reached to 959 million dirhams from 517.3 million dirhams. Emaar posted a 27 percent decline in full-year profit on Feb. 14 and provided a breakdown of revenue today. Global house prices edged higher in 2011
March 8, 2012 by DubaiChronicle.com · Comments Off
Global House Price Index could slip into negative territory during 2012
The property market in Brazil was the strongest performing globally last year, while Ireland was the worst, according to the Knight Frank Global House Price Index, which tracks the performance of mainstream house prices worldwide.
International researcher Kate Everett-Allen reports that the Index rose 0.5% in 2011, despite a 0.3% decline in the final quarter of the year. Read more
